Originally Posted by Teamdarb
This is a good read. As I had started on a 420 with a half step and rarely found use of the granny, too. I do not spin when riding and like a good gear transition. This has me rethinking my current 520 with its 48 36 22 and 12-36 to swap that 36 to a 42. I wonder what that will do?

22, 42, 48 wouldn’t be a good half step plus granny. That would be more of a “one step” meaning each time you dropped down one and one you would be in nearly the exact same gear you were in.
If you feel 42t would be a more correct center ring for you then the outer at 45t as I did would give you the half’s and not lower your top gear a great amount.
